Lance Corporal WILLIAM JAMES THOMAS KELLY

Service Number: 2930
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Australian Infantry, A.I.F.

18th Bn.

Date of Death

Died 10 December 1918

Age 25 years old

Buried or commemorated at

LE CATEAU COMMUNAL CEMETERY

I. 56.

France

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service Australian
  • Awards Military Medal
  • Additional Info Son of Andrew James and Elizabeth Jane Ann Kelly of Bungarby Post Office, New South Wales. Born at Cooma.
  • Personal Inscription MY BOY IS SLEEPING HIS LAST LONG SLEEP HIS GRAVE I MAY NEVER SEE
